There is a Highlander reboot in early development. Henry Cavil used to be attached (presumably to play Conner), but he left the project earlier this week. Reportedly, Chris Hemsworth has replaced him as the lead.

This looks like it will be a movie and not a series. Too bad. The only good movie from the original franchise was the first movie. But the series was really good and could do very well in a reboot (improved budget and being able to delve deeper into the universe of the Watchers and maybe play with the origin of the immortals).
